Bordubi No.1 Population - Dibrugarh, Assam
Bordubi No.1 is a medium size village located in Tengakhat Circle of Dibrugarh district, Assam with total 227 families residing. The Bordubi No.1 village has population of 1136 of which 579 are males while 557 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Bordubi No.1 village population of children with age 0-6 is 167 which makes up 14.70 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Bordubi No.1 village is 962 which is higher than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Bordubi No.1 as per census is 876, lower than Assam average of 962.
Bordubi No.1 village has lower liter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Bordubi No.1 village was 66.98 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Bordubi No.1 Male literacy stands at 76.33 % while female literacy rate was 57.41 %.

Bordubi No.1 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 227 | - | - |
Population | 1,136 | 579 | 557 |
Child (0-6) | 167 | 89 | 78 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 66.98 % | 76.33 % | 57.41 % |
Total Workers | 462 | 329 | 133 |
Main Worker | 428 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 34 | 19 | 15 |
